Mandarin Orange and Apple Salad Recipe

For the salad
- 1 can drained mandarin oranges 11 ounces
- 1 apple
- ½ cup celery
- 1 teaspoon fresh lemon juice
For the dressing
- ⅓ cup low-fat mayonnaise
- ¼ cup low-fat milk
- 1 teaspoon sugar
- zest of 1 lemon
- 1 teaspoon fresh lemon juice
- 2 tablespoons chopped walnuts
- lettuce leaves to serve salad on if desired, but not necessary
Prep the fruit and celery: Chop the apple and celery. In a medium bowl, toss the apple with 1 teaspoon of lemon juice to keep it from browning. Add the drained mandarin oranges and celery, and gently stir to combine.
1 can drained mandarin oranges, 1 apple, ½ cup celery, 1 teaspoon fresh lemon juice
Make the dressing: In a small bowl, whisk together mayonnaise, milk, sugar, lemon zest, and lemon juice until smooth and creamy. This zesty dressing brings all the flavors together perfectly.
⅓ cup low-fat mayonnaise, ¼ cup low-fat milk, 1 teaspoon sugar, zest of 1 lemon, 1 teaspoon fresh lemon juice
Assemble the salad: You have two options for serving:Individual plates: Place lettuce leaves on 4 salad plates and portion the fruit mixture on top.Single serving bowl: Place the fruit mixture in a serving bowl.Drizzle the creamy dressing over the salad and sprinkle with chopped walnuts for a crunchy finish. Serve immediately, or store the dressing and fruit salad separately and chill for a refreshing, make-ahead side dish. 2 tablespoons chopped walnuts, lettuce leaves
Keep the salad and dressing separate in the fridge. Use airtight containers and enjoy within a few days.
